The people behind the papers - Allan Spradling and Wayne (Yunpeng) Fu
None:
In most species, ovarian follicles are thought to develop using a single pathway. However, in their study, Allan Spradling and Wayne (Yunpeng) Fu show that female Drosophila primordial germ cells (PGCs) give rise to three distinct follicular waves, which closely resemble the three waves of mouse follicles, during early ovarian development. To learn more about their work, we talked to the first author Wayne (Yunpeng) Fu, as well as the corresponding author, Allan Spradling, Principal Investigator at the Carnegie Institution for Science and the Howard Hughes Medical Institute, USA.
